Top reasons to visit Eastern Norway

  • Stunning Outdoor Adventures: Eastern Norway is perfect for outdoor enthusiasts, offering skiing, hiking, and delightful camping experiences amidst breathtaking landscapes.
  • Cultural Landmarks: Explore charming churches, historic bridges, and the vibrant capital, Oslo, rich in history and modern flair.
  • Picturesque Coastal Towns: Visit Fredrikstad’s Gamlebyen for charming streets and stunning fjord views, ideal for leisurely strolls.
  • Diverse Accommodation Options: Choose from charming pensions to luxurious hotels, catering to various preferences and ensuring comfort.
  • Year-Round Activities: Experience a variety of activities for all seasons, from skiing in winter to summer seaside walks.

Shopping

In Eastern Norway, you can explore the charming shops in downtown Oslo or visit the bustling Elverum Storsenter for a variety of stores. If you're up for a drive, check out Torp Shopping Centre in Sandefjord for a larger selection of brands and local goods.

Recreation

Skei Golf Club offers a luxurious atmosphere for golf enthusiasts, featuring pristine greens and stunning landscapes, perfect for relaxation. Meanwhile, Ruten provides a tranquil recreational area, ideal for unwinding amidst nature, with ample opportunities for wellness activities and rejuvenation.

Adventure

Experience the thrill of skiing at Kvitfjell Ski Resort, located 18.6km from Eastern Norway, where you can enjoy exhilarating slopes and stunning mountain views. Alternatively, visit Valdres Alpinsenter, 8.7km away, for outdoor adventures in a picturesque setting, or ride the Ola Express ski lift, 13.7km away, for breathtaking vistas.

Nightlife

Experience the vibrant nightlife of Eastern Norway by visiting the lively bars in Oslo, such as the trendy Blå, known for its live music, or the chic Himkok, offering craft cocktails. For a more relaxed evening, try the cosy pubs in Drammen, perfect for mingling with locals.

Best time to go to Eastern Norway

The best time to visit Eastern Norway can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Eastern Norway falls in June, when visitor numbers are high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ature around Eastern Norway falls in February,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with no rain (dry).

The nearest major airports for your trip to Eastern Norway

When visiting Eastern Norway, the major airports to consider are Oslo (OSL-Gardermoen), Sälen (SCR-Scandinavian Mountains), and Sogndal (SOG-Haukasen). Oslo Airport is approximately 46.0km from Eastern Norway, with nearby hotels such as the 5-star Lily Country Club, 5.0km away, and the 4-star Radisson Blu Airport Hotel, only 62m from the terminal. Sälen Airport is about 63.4km away, with the 3-star Mountain Lodge located 5.0km from the airport. Lastly, Sogndal Airport is around 55.3km distant, offering options like the 4-star Quality Hotel Sogndal, just 3.1km away.
